HAUSER, the internationally acclaimed cellist known for his expressive performances, has once again captured the attention of audiences around the world with his stunning interpretation of “Bésame Mucho”. The famous song, originally written by Mexican composer Consuelo Velázquez in 1940, has been covered by countless artists in various styles. However, HAUSER’s emotive and virtuosic version of the classic brings a fresh and unique element to the piece, showcasing his exceptional talent and his ability to evoke deep emotion through his instrument.

HAUSER - Bésame Mucho 😘 #hauser #bésamemucho #cello #music - YouTube

“Bésame Mucho” is one of the most well-known and beloved songs in Latin American music. The title translates to “Kiss Me a Lot,” and the song’s lyrics, imbued with longing and passion, have made it a timeless ballad. Although originally written as a bolero, the song has since been interpreted in many different genres, from jazz to pop to classical.
